The plastic ones won't "Glow" well at all. Avoid them.
The best Glow is with the Dot centered over the bulb. (for anyone that wanted them on another car, gotta be directly centered over the bulb.)
I have a few spare pairs laying around, always like to keep a couple sets in my tool box. A guy on ebay sells real glass blue dots for 9.99 a set with free shipping.
I never thought about the white vs chrome background, funny you'd think the Chrome inside would give a better effect.

On the HHR, because the rear lights are on a slight angle, the light does not go directly thru the Blue-Dots. That's why no glow, like we're used to..
I have em on my bikes also, here's Ol Ruby my 97 FLHR (15 lights in all)...
Edit: If you paint the reflectors a Hi-Gloss White, I find the lights are Brighter..
